Oba Femi returns to NXT

Oba Femi returned to NXT last night during the closing moments of the show after Ricky Saints defeated Trick Williams in a last man standing match to retain the NXT title.

With the credits rolling and Saints in the middle of the ring about to celebrate, the house lights went dark and the green laser shot up as Femi’s theme song kicked in to a big pop from the crowd.

“The ruler is here,” screamed Vic Joseph on commentary, as Femi made his way out, standing at the top of the stage with just his silhouette visible among the smoke and lights.

Femi has been off WWE television since September and the NXT No Mercy premium live event where he lost the NXT title to Saints.
